Private Client Solicitor/Lawyer (3PQE+)

I'm working with a respected Legal 500 firm,growing and looking for an experienced Private Client Solicitor/Lawyer to join theirfriendly team Bristol. If you enjoy working closely with clients on estate administration, Trusts, Wills, tax planning, and Lasting Powers of Attorney, this could be the perfect role for you.

You’ll be a key part of theteam, offering expert advice tailored to each client’s needs. Your role will involve everything from handling client matters and supervising support staff to staying up to date with legal changes and providing training forfee earners.

You’ll also play a part in business development and ensuring financial best practices, all while working within regulatory requirements. Most importantly, you’ll be part of a team that values collaboration, knowledge-sharing, and client-focused service.

The firm pride themselves on being a bit different. They’re well-known in the Bristol legal market for excellent service, but also for the way theylook after theirpeople. Work-life balance isn’t just something theytalk about - it’ssomething theygenuinely support.

Ideally, you'll be a qualified Solicitor with at least 3PQE,or an FCILEx with expertise in Wills, LPAs, Trusts, and estate and Trust Administration. If you have experience with Trust work and a strong understanding of tax matters (including IHT, CGT, and Income Tax), even better. A STEP qualification (or a willingness to work towards one) would be a plus, and if you’ve managed a team before, that’s a great advantage too.

This is a full-time role, with office hours from 9-5. You’ll be based in Bishopston, with the option for hybrid working post probation.

On offer is a comprehensive benefits package, including a minimum of 25 days' holiday (with the potential for more through tenure or purchase schemes), flexible and hybrid working options, pension contributions, death-in-service benefits, and annual bonuses. Employees receive support for professional development, discounted legal services, childcare vouchers, season ticket loans, health cash plans, and access to a virtual GP and counselling services. Social perks include summer and Christmas events, long service awards, and opportunities to join committees focused on charity, diversity, wellbeing, and staff development.
